EUREKA – A Minimal Operational Prototype of a Blockchain-based Rating and Publishing System
Today’s number of reputable academical publishers is dominated by few key players. This imbalance of supply and demand in publishing academic work makes the entire process inefficient. EUREKA is a blockchain-based scientific publishing platform, developed to address this imbalance. It offers the opportunity of a fair reward distribution for all contributors and immediate ownership rights to authors of an article. For the demonstration, the platform including the back-end and frontend integrated into the Ethereum blockchain is shown, and the interaction processes of users i.e., authors and reviewers are presented.
